Can I Reprint My Lifetime Missouri Fishing Permit?

Visit the permit vendor's website, https://mdc-web.s3licensing.com. Select “Manage Your Account” from the list of buttons. Enter your identification information. Select “View / Reprint My Permit History” from the list of options.

What is Missouri Conservation permit card?

The Missouri Conservation Permit Card makes buying hunting and fishing permits a breeze . Stores Your Conservation Info and Permits. The Conservation Permit Card, which looks like a credit card, provides a durable alternative to carrying your permits in paper or electronic form while in the field.

What is a PA state conservation ID?

What is a CID? A CID is a customer identification number . When you purchase a license through PALS, the system will assign you a nine-digit CID that will be printed on your license. Your CID is your permanent identification number in PALS and identifies you in the database.

What are the White River border lakes?

A White River Border Lakes License is available for a $10 annual fee. This license allows Arkansas residents who hold a valid license to fish in the Missouri waters of Bull Shoals, Norfork and Table Rock lakes without a fishing license from Missouri.

What do you need to duck hunt in Missouri?

A Federal Duck Stamp is required for residents and nonresidents age 16 years and older who hunt waterfowl. Hunters also need the appropriate Missouri hunting permits. To be valid, the Federal Duck Stamp must be signed in ink across the face.

Can you fish for free on Sundays in PA?

Sunday is one of Pennsylvania's designated fish-for-free days . Anyone can legally fish a stream, river or lake with no license required. Trout and salmon permits and Lake Erie Permits also are not required.
